钒酸盐对糖尿病大鼠骨骼肌GLUT_4基因表达的影响 被引量:1

The effect of vanadate on expression of GLUT 4 gene in skeletal muscle of diabetic rats

摘要 观察了钒酸钠对STZ糖尿病大鼠糖代谢的影响,并对这一作用产生的机理进行了探讨。以0.5mg/ml钒酸钠溶液作为饮用水治疗三周后,糖尿病治疗组的血糖低于非治疗组37.5%,但仍较正常组高。而骨骼肌中GLUT4mRNA含量较非治疗组高73.8%,但仍低于正常组。结果提示,钒酸盐能促进外周组织GLUT4基因表达,这可能是其具有降血糖作用的原因之一。 The effect of vanadate on glucose metabolism and its mechanism in STZ diabetic rats were studied. The diabetic rats were treated with 0.5mg/ml sodium orthovanuda solution as drinking water.After 3 weeks treatment, the blood glucose was 37.5% lower in treated diabetic rats than in untreated diabetic rats, and dot blot analysis showed skeletal muscle GLUT 4 mRNA was 73.8% higher in treated diabetic rats.The results indicated that vanadate treatment improved glucose metabolism through enhanced GLUT 4 expression in skeletal muscle of STZ diabetic rats.
